On the eve of the decisive battle, Goethe Nasis led 3000 royal guards to Rhine City in the name of the supreme commander.

When the players saw this legendary young man again …

Many players who joined the Freedom Alliance understood that he was the ruler of the Kingdom and the founder of the Freedom Alliance.

That was him.

He was the man who had sounded the Horn of Freedom.

The appearance of Goethe Nasis brought hope to the players. At the same time, it boosted the morale of the officers who were born as commoners.

What was even more shocking was the Advanced NPC named Lansett Steel. He was an expert who had surpassed the upper limit of the version …

At this moment.

Goethe stood on the thirty-meter high city wall and looked down at the endless Black Lava Nation's army. He was deep in thought.

The middle-aged man beside him was smiling. He seemed to be reminiscing about a beautiful future.

Goethe Nasis turned his head and smiled. "Uncle Lansett, have you thought of something interesting?"

"You shouldn't call me uncle. Ever since I tested your bloodline and turned your father into a puppet, you're the King of this nation. We're just your subjects."

Lansett raised his eyebrows and glanced at Goethe with twinkling eyes. "You're quite daring to allow them to invade Rhine City."

"After the Lord of the City of Dawn joined the battle as a mercenary team, I had to give up on the long offensive and defensive battles. Nedrick was also ambitious. Why didn't I allow the Iron Nation army to retreat in defeat and let them feel that we can't do it?" Goethe opened his arms to embrace the heavens and the earth.

His eyes were filled with ambition and hatred. He suddenly turned his head and said emotionlessly, "If William dares to be the vanguard, kill him. I want him dead!"

"Yes, Your Majesty." Lansett smiled and knelt on one knee. He looked at his nephew in front of him. He felt as though he was looking at his past self.



Below the city wall.

Some people were looking up at the city wall.

Nedrick Blackstone was wearing a set of shiny black armor. His long battle robe dragged on the ground. He stood in front of the tens of thousands of soldiers and closed his eyes to embrace the city wall.

After a long time.

He heard footsteps and slowly opened his eyes to look at the newcomer. With a smile in his eyes, he said, "You're here?"

"You chopped off one of my disciple's arms. If you can't avenge me, can't I do it myself?"

This black-robed middle-aged man had his right hand on the hilt of his sword the entire time, giving off the feeling of a sharp edge piercing one's throat.

He looked coldly at Rhine City. "Bastet lost his right arm. I have already sent him away. I hope that the distance can help him regrow his lost arm. His potential cannot stop here. But we must avenge the loss of his arm."

Handur, a high-level warrior from the Black Lava Kingdom.

Nedrick looked at Handur, who had already left, his eyes filled with complicated emotions.

This middle-aged man was once his father's swordsmanship teacher.

His disciple was his sword art teacher.

"Now, Lansett should have appeared, right?" He squinted his eyes, and the corners of his mouth curled up slightly.

He didn't think he would lose.

Not only did he trust himself, but he also trusted his ambitious ally.

"Do you really think that I don't know anything about your actions?" Nedrick laughed softly and turned his back to Rhine City. He was fearless.



The army of the City of Dawn was on the left flank. No one knew how long this final battle would last.

But they knew that the entire [Gods] was paying attention to this epic main storyline war.

The foreign players from other continents had not reached this stage, especially since the main storyline missions of different continents were different.

Only the European and American players could enjoy a similar war between nations.

The players from other continents were participating in the main storyline missions related to the dark creatures.

Therefore, the foreign players could only go to their forums and secretly watch the live broadcasts. They didn't dare to comment on the comments, or else they would be ridiculed.

Chu Liuqiu, Forever Alone, Angry Fatty, Changli Jiuge, and a group of guild leaders entered William's tent to participate in an important meeting.

There weren't many people in the tent.

Legolas, Lautner, and the rest were resting with their eyes closed.

The players were also discussing their own matters in low voices.

Chu Liuqiu stroked his chin and looked around. He was puzzled. "Where is Prince William? Ever since his personal guards returned to the city, he hasn't come over. Is he planning to slack off in this war?"

"I don't know if he's slacking off, but I know that your information network is terrible." Golden Era's Forever Alone, Chu Liuqiu's old rival, looked at Forever Alone and said, "Those personal guards haven't returned, but it's enough that Prince William is back. Do you think that Prince William will leave now?"

"Cut the crap. Our leader is talking about what Her Highness is planning to do in this war. As a mercenary group, we are sandwiched between two dukedoms. No matter what the outcome of this war is, we might be abandoned!" Xiao Ayin glanced at Forever Alone in disdain.

Forever Alone's mouth twitched. Suddenly, he smiled and moved closer to Xiao Ayin. "Miss Ayin, you're smart. But you know that if the Black Lava Nation doesn't want us, we can go to the City of Dawn. As for what you said, shouldn't it be the NPCs' consideration?"

Chu Liuqiu pushed Forever Alone's head away. "But we have to pursue our own interests. The NPCs are too intelligent. I'm afraid they'll go back on their words …"

Then, he looked at Forever Alone warily. "Let me tell you, don't get too close to Ayin. Your Golden Era is trying to poach players from other teams. Don't you know how many players you've poached from other teams?"

"Your words are so harsh. Changing clubs is voluntary. Do you think I can force you to buy or sell?" Forever Alone muttered a few words, then hurriedly sat up straight and stopped talking nonsense.

William suddenly lifted the tent flap and strode towards the main seat in the conference room.

"Prince William!"

"Lord William!"

William nodded his head nonchalantly as the crowd called him a mess.

Then, he glanced at the players in the conference room. They would be a great help in this war.

William pondered for a while and said bluntly, "We don't know how long this war will last. Both sides have sufficient resources. Do you have any ideas on how to quickly defeat the enemy?"

The conference room was very quiet.

After everyone present saw Rhine City, which was sandwiched between two large mountains, they knew that this would be an extremely difficult battle. Using tricks … was too difficult.

William was just speaking casually. He did not expect them to come up with any ideas.

When he saw that no one spoke, he said in a deep voice, "Then we'll follow the Black Lava Nation's method of attrition. Chu Liuqiu, you'll continue to be the commander."

Chu Liuqiu was a little surprised when he was called. He quickly stood up and patted his chest. "Yes, Prince William."

"In the next few days, I might leave for a period of time. I hope that you won't disappoint me." William looked at them deeply and left the conference room.

This conspiracy that would decide the outcome of the war.

This was the key to victory.

This was his next move.

He wanted to be sure.

It was foolproof.
